Received: from mail-la0-f62.google.com ([209.85.215.62]:33380) by stodi.digitalkingdom.org with esmtps (TLSv1.2:AES128-GCM-SHA256:128) (Exim 4.80.1) (envelope-from ) id 1YdeMO-0004oz-U6; Thu, 02 Apr 2015 05:36:41 -0700 Received: by labgd6 with SMTP id gd6sf15723828lab.0; Thu, 02 Apr 2015 05:36:29 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=googlegroups.com; s=20120806; h=mime-version:in-reply-to:references:date:message-id:subject:from:to :content-type:x-original-sender:x-original-authentication-results :reply-to:precedence:mailing-list:list-id:list-post:list-help :list-archive:sender:list-subscribe:list-unsubscribe; bh=TLNu7SmlCuoRpQyfCZ9563wcRx1oxn9LFMttq/0SoFE=; b=ZZlSYzYm3hr2NqIqIQt31vbAvtiM3Ow72ulqboywyEiNiB5IJA8THVULtqi71d4hcM q9QhhPGGuxq9zU+spCJyQPi6Gg4bDh+RUxvlinIR/p2EYxPO864ff+XC4C3GrbTJqGfM OY1gKCw91kOrAdObASCF+CXydnjZ6/6kZ25QIrkXIGN3Ep7G8ah4x7A79/c5mwKXxZxF BfTJYf8m5xY5czz7bYg7jb82us/Df4a6xrhn/knLfbO9MmtXKzWggvAUZQi0GeYSNntb PDEv5b6KOrNo4TwWiywRiEZVcSMVV/BF0RprGBYQUnNuFgslLWMDo89ZC4sMlxt+sDaM vnUA== X-Received: by 10.180.78.167 with SMTP id c7mr135718wix.4.1427978189909; Thu, 02 Apr 2015 05:36:29 -0700 (PDT) X-BeenThere: bpfk-list@googlegroups.com Received: by 10.180.97.102 with SMTP id dz6ls731422wib.41.canary; Thu, 02 Apr 2015 05:36:29 -0700 (PDT) X-Received: by 10.180.23.40 with SMTP id j8mr3122807wif.2.1427978189590; Thu, 02 Apr 2015 05:36:29 -0700 (PDT) Received: from mail-wg0-x233.google.com (mail-wg0-x233.google.com. [2a00:1450:400c:c00::233]) by gmr-mx.google.com with ESMTPS id i8si303504wif.1.2015.04.02.05.36.29 for (version=TLSv1.2 cipher=ECDHE-RSA-AES128-GCM-SHA256 bits=128/128); Thu, 02 Apr 2015 05:36:29 -0700 (PDT) Received-SPF: pass (google.com: domain of jjllambias@gmail.com designates 2a00:1450:400c:c00::233 as permitted sender) client-ip=2a00:1450:400c:c00::233; Received: by mail-wg0-x233.google.com with SMTP id e14so83412629wgo.0 for ; Thu, 02 Apr 2015 05:36:29 -0700 (PDT) MIME-Version: 1.0 X-Received: by 10.180.94.199 with SMTP id de7mr24495159wib.53.1427978189494; Thu, 02 Apr 2015 05:36:29 -0700 (PDT) Received: by 10.27.56.72 with HTTP; Thu, 2 Apr 2015 05:36:29 -0700 (PDT) In-Reply-To: References: Date: Thu, 2 Apr 2015 09:36:29 -0300 Message-ID: Subject: Re: [bpfk] Improvements to fragments in ilmentufa parser From: =?UTF-8?Q?Jorge_Llamb=C3=ADas?= To: bpfk-list@googlegroups.com Content-Type: multipart/alternative; boundary=f46d04447e9fbb5f650512bd1410 X-Original-Sender: jjllambias@gmail.com X-Original-Authentication-Results: gmr-mx.google.com; spf=pass (google.com: domain of jjllambias@gmail.com designates 2a00:1450:400c:c00::233 as permitted sender) smtp.mail=jjllambias@gmail.com; dkim=pass header.i=@gmail.com; dmarc=pass (p=NONE dis=NONE) header.from=gmail.com Reply-To: bpfk-list@googlegroups.com Precedence: list Mailing-list: list bpfk-list@googlegroups.com; contact bpfk-list+owners@googlegroups.com List-ID: X-Google-Group-Id: 972099695765 List-Post: , List-Help: , List-Archive: , List-Unsubscribe: , X-Spam-Score: -1.7 (-) X-Spam_score: -1.7 X-Spam_score_int: -16 X-Spam_bar: - --f46d04447e9fbb5f650512bd1410 Content-Type: text/plain; charset=UTF-8 On Thu, Apr 2, 2015 at 9:16 AM, Gleki Arxokuna wrote: > Okay, I implemented them here: > > http://vrici.lojban.org/~gleki/mediawiki-1.19.2/extensions/ilmentufa/ircbot/naxle.html > That's a great resource! The grammar is still here in this "ugly" javascript format but I have no > problems adding your suggestions there: > https://github.com/Ilmen-vodhr/ilmentufa/blob/master/camxes-exp.js.peg > Still needs the "!tag !term" in front of "quantifier" in "fragment". Otherwise "pa roi" and "pa ko'a" fail. You may safely continue using original peg format since as I can assume you > can test it as well. > I could, with lots of work, I can't without lots of work. >> Or maybe: >> >> fragment <- ek free* / !term !tag quantifier / relative-clauses / >> links / linkargs >> >> otherwise the "pa" in "pa ko'a" and "pa roi" would be absorbed as a >> fragment. >> > mu'o mi'e xorxes -- You received this message because you are subscribed to the Google Groups "BPFK" group. To unsubscribe from this group and stop receiving emails from it, send an email to bpfk-list+unsubscribe@googlegroups.com. To post to this group, send email to bpfk-list@googlegroups.com. Visit this group at http://groups.google.com/group/bpfk-list. For more options, visit https://groups.google.com/d/optout. --f46d04447e9fbb5f650512bd1410 Content-Type: text/html; charset=UTF-8 Content-Transfer-Encoding: quoted-printable


On Thu, Apr 2, 2015 at 9:16 AM, Gleki Arxokuna <gleki.is.my.n= ame@gmail.com> wrote:

T= hat's a great resource!=C2=A0

The grammar is still here in this "ugl= y" javascript format but I have no problems adding your suggestions th= ere:=C2=A0https://github.com/Ilmen-vodhr/ilmentuf= a/blob/master/camxes-exp.js.peg

=
Still needs the "!tag !term" in front of "quantifier&qu= ot; in "fragment". Otherwise "pa roi" and "pa ko&#= 39;a" fail.

You may safely continue using original peg format since as I= can assume you can test it as well.

I could, with lots of work, I can't without lots of work.


Or maybe:

=C2=A0=C2= =A0fragment <- ek free* / !term !tag quantifier / rela= tive-clauses / links / linkargs

otherwise the "pa" in "pa ko= 'a" and "pa roi" would be absorbed as a fragment.=
<= div>
mu'o mi'e xorxes
=C2=A0

--
You received this message because you are subscribed to the Google Groups &= quot;BPFK" group.
To unsubscribe from this group and stop receiving emails from it, send an e= mail to bpfk-list= +unsubscribe@googlegroups.com.
To post to this group, send email to bpfk-list@googlegroups.com.
Visit this group at ht= tp://groups.google.com/group/bpfk-list.
For more options, visit http= s://groups.google.com/d/optout.
--f46d04447e9fbb5f650512bd1410--